Should I have my solar panel system checked? With our solar panel MOT, you can have a full inspection done.

Zonnefabriek places a high value on service, which is why we introduced the MOT (like the roadworthiness test for cars: APK in Dutch) for solar panels.

Especially with older systems, which didn't have the option to be monitored online at the time, it's worthwhile to have the system thoroughly checked by one of our experts to ensure everything is functioning properly and the expected energy yield is being achieved. During an MOT for solar panels, a full inspection of the PV system will be conducted according to the NEN1010 / NEN-IEC 62446 guidelines. This is done using a thermal camera to locate any hotspots. Any minor repairs will be carried out on-site.
